Economics


Economics analyzes production, distribution, and consumption of goods and services, offering tools for decision-making and policy development. Additionally, candidates seeking admission into the Economics department under Faculty of Social Sciences, must have at least five (5) credits (C5 and more) in their SSCE disciplines, including the following:


  • English Language,


  • Mathematics,


  • Economics and


  • any two (2) of Arts or Social Science subjects.

Pure Chemistry


Pure Chemistry focuses on fundamental chemical theories, reactions, and properties, forming the basis for careers in academia, laboratories, and industry. Moreover, candidates aspiring to gain admission into Pure Chemistry department under Faculty of Science, should at least obtain five (5) credit (C5 and above) passes in their SSCE subjects including:


  • English Language,


  • Physics,


  • Chemistry,


  • Biology and


  • Mathematics.


Statistics


Statistics provides tools for data collection, analysis, and interpretation across diverse fields. Furthermore, candidates seeking admission into the Statistics department under Faculty of Science, must have at least five (5) credits (C5 and more) in their SSCE disciplines, including the following:


  • English Language,


  • Mathematics,


  • Physics,


  • Chemistry and


  • any other relevant subject.



Procedure for University Course Accreditation


Accreditation of University courses is a vital procedure that guarantees the caliber and norms of educational offerings from schools. An outline of the accrediting procedure is provided below:

  • Recognize the Different Types of Accreditation: Generally bestowed by regional accrediting organizations, regional accreditation attests to the general excellence and standards of an establishment.


  • Eligibility Assessment: University must fulfill requirements for eligibility established by accrediting bodies. These requirements may include things like buildings, governance structure, faculty qualifications, and financial stability.


  • Peer Assessment: Review by peer assessments are carried out by University course accrediting bodies, in which specialists from different educational institutions visit the campus, examine the self-study report of the institution, and speak with faculty, staff, and students.


  • Evaluation of Standards: Curriculum, Faculty Qualifications, Student Support Services, Facilities, Governance, and Institutional Effectiveness are some of the topics that are usually covered by accreditation standards.


  • Accreditation Decision: The accrediting organization decides on accreditation status based on the self-study report, peer review appraisal, and compliance with accreditation standards.

    This choice could lead to denial, probation, or accreditation. Institutions may receive accreditation for a predetermined amount of time, after which they must reapply for accreditation.


  • Continuous Improvement: To keep their accreditation sparklyn_status, accredited schools must participate in continual evaluation and development activities. They need to show that they are dedicated to improving quality, addressing the areas that the certification process found needed improvement.


  • Positive Aspects of Accreditation: University and their programs get greater legitimacy and recognition when they are accredited. It provides reassurance on the caliber and intensity of education given to students, employers, and other relevant parties. Transfer of credits, financial aid eligibility, and professional certification or licensure may all be facilitated by accreditation.
